Chinese Buffet Crab Casserole Recipe Ingredients

Lots of pantry ingredients here – and I have Imitation crab meat on hand because it’s such a low-cal snack! Here’s what you’ll need:

  • Imitation Crab Meat – Look for FLAKE style or CHUNK imitation crab meat.
  • Cheeses: Mozzarella & Colby Jack – you can also use cheddar cheese – I like the mild flavor of the cojack
  • Dairy: Sour Cream & Cream Cheese – if you’re out of cream cheese, just double up the sour cream. I would NOT go the other way – the half package cream cheese would be too overwhelming to the taste
  • Veggies: Celery & Green Onions – these add a nice crunch
  • Mayonnaise – any mayo will do but I like Duke’s
  • Worcestershire sauce
  • Lemon juice
  • Garlic Salt – you could also use garlic powder or onion powder

Recipe Variations

  • Real Crab – you could get fancy and use real crab meat but it might be overwhelmed by the cheese and cream cheese – so you might want to use a little less of those. It would be a lot pricier casserole as well and the Chinese buffet always uses imitation. 😉
  • Shrimp – cooked shrimp would be a good swap for the imitation crab meat as well
  • Veggies – you could also add in finely diced green pepper

How to make Chinese Buffet Crab Casserole

This is an easy casserole to make – stir it all together and bake! So delicious!

  1. Preheat the oven to 325º F.
  2. In a large mixing bowl – combine crab meat, HALF of the mozzarella cheese, HALF of the Colby jack cheese, celery, sour cream, green onions, cream cheese, mayonnaise, Worcestershire, lemon juice and a pinch garlic salt. Using a spatula, stir well to combine.
  3. Spoon into a greased casserole dish (8×8 or round) and top with the remaining cheese.
  4. Place into the oven and bake for 20 minutes or until the cheese is golden brown and the casserole is bubbly.

What is imitation crab meat?

Imitation crab meat is made from minced white fish, like pollock. It’s pressed into shapes that LOOSELY resemble crab legs. I really don’t think it tastes like real crab meat but I do like it! Dipping in cocktail sauce is a very healthy snack!

How do you store & reheat leftover crab casserole?

Store leftovers in an airtight container (I like these glass storage ones) in the refrigerator for up to a week. You can freeze up to three months. Reheat in the microwave for 1-2 minutes. 

Can you freeze Imitation Crab Casserole?

I wouldn’t put this in the freezer. There’s a lot of dairy in this – and it’s much better fresh. You can reheat it though! Since I’m by myself – I actually had this for dinner a couple nights in one week!

Ingredients
  

  • 8 oz imitation crab meat flake or chunk
  • 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ese shredded
  • 1/2 cup colby jack cheese shredded
  • 1/2 cup celery diced (2 small stalks)
  • 1/4 cup green onions th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 2 oz cream cheese softened, 1/4 package
  • 2 tbsp mayonnaise
  • 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tbsp Lemon juice
  • 1/4 tsp garlic salt

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 325º F.
  • In a large mixing bowl – combine crab meat, HALF of the mozzarella cheese, HALF of the Colby jack cheese, celery, sour cream, white ends from green onions, cream cheese, mayonnaise, Worcestershire, lemon juice and a pinch garlic salt. Using a spatula, stir well to combine.
    8 oz imitation crab meat, 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ese, 1/2 cup colby jack cheese, 1/2 cup celery, 1/4 cup green onions, 1/4 cup sour cream, 2 oz cream cheese, 2 tbsp mayonnaise, 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ce, 1 tbsp Lemon juice, 1/4 tsp garlic salt
  • Spoon into a greased casserole dish (8×8 or round) and top with the remaining cheese.
    1/2 cup mozzarella cheese, 1/2 cup colby jack cheese
  • Place into the oven and bake for 20 minutes or until the cheese is golden brown and the casserole is bubbly.
  • Sprinkle with green ends of green onions and serve.
    1/4 cup green onions
